Summary
This summary covers two available inspections for Crystal Rose Velo from January 5, 2026 through February 12, 2026.
One inspection recorded a violation, with nine recorded violations in total.
The most recent higher-concern violation was on January 5, 2026 and involved equipment or readiness.
A later inspection showed no recorded violations, but the records do not say whether it was a formal follow-up.
